In modern contexts, Disciples of Christ may refer to:
Christian Church (Disciples of Christ), a current mainline Protestant denomination in North America that is descended from the Campbell movement often referred to as "Disciples of Christ"
Disciples of Christ (Campbell Movement), a Christian group that arose during the Second Great Awakening of the early 19th century and later became part of the Restoration Movement
Disciple of Christ (abbreviated as D.Ch.), title awarded by
West Kalimantan Christian Church for those who have completed courses of the church discipleship program
